Handbrake numbers

Just to let some people know, I've got the 8 core - 2.8 mac pro (stock configuration) and its averaging about 110 fps on the ipod high-rez settings (H.264) coming from a dvd movie. Thats while I'm browsing the internet. Its using around 600% of the processor. Its simply amazing!

So I got my ram today. Now have 10gb in the mac pro. It is definitely feeling faster. Surfing the web is without a doubt snappier BUT I ran the same encoding test with the new ram and guess what. SAME exact time. Interesting. I guess its not a ram intensive process to encode video. I would not have thought so.
